Section 1: Understanding the Basics of Tag Study Plans

Tag study plans are digital tools that help students organize and prioritize their study materials and tasks. They work by allowing students to tag their resources with specific keywords or topics, making it easier to find and revisit important information. For instance, a tag like "calculus" can be attached to all calculus-related notes, videos, and assignments, making it simple to review the entire topic at any time.

# Practical Insight:

Imagine you are preparing for an exam in a complex subject like organic chemistry. Instead of sifting through countless notes and resources, you can quickly filter by the tag "organic chemistry" to find all relevant materials. This saves a lot of time and helps you focus more effectively on your studies.

Section 3: Benefits and Challenges of Implementing Tag Study Plans

# Benefits:

1. Enhanced Organization: Tagging helps students organize their resources more efficiently.

2. Improved Accessibility: Tagged materials are easier to find and review.

3. Customizable Learning Paths: Students can tailor their study plans based on their needs.

# Challenges:

1. Initial Setup: Setting up and maintaining a system of tags can be time-consuming.

2. Consistency: Ensuring consistent tagging across all resources can be challenging.

3. Overwhelm: A large number of tags can sometimes make it harder to find what you’re looking for.

# Practical Insight:

To overcome these challenges, it’s recommended to start small and gradually expand your tagging system. Tools like mind mapping software can help visualize how different tags relate to each other, making the process more manageable.
